Interest rate risk:
◦ SPV issues pass-through securities – payments to investors are based on
cash flows from the pool so SPV is not subject to interest rate risk
◦ SIV issues commercial paper so their profits depend on the difference
between the commercial paper rate and the mortgage rate (interest rate risk)

Profits:
◦ SPV earns profits from fees on originating and servicing the ABS
◦ SIV earns fees as well as the spread between CP and mortgage rates

Financing:
◦ SPV issues pass-through or asset backed securities
◦ SIV issues commercial paper (ABCP)

FI builds a pool of mortgages and sells interest in the pool as
pass-through securities

Pass-through securities represent a fraction of ownership in
the pool
◦ e.g. a 1% share in the principal and interest payments of the pool

The originator of the pass-through collects payments from the
pool and passes them through to the bond holders

Investors have direct ownership in this portfolio of mortgage
loans or other securitized assets.

Ownership of loans rests with certificate holders (investors)
and pass-throughs don’t appear on the originating bank’s B/S.

Founded in 1968 after splitting from FNMA

Ginnie Mae does not buy or sell loans or issue mortgage-backed
securities (MBS)

Main Functions
◦ Sponsoring mortgage backed securities programs by FIs – banks, thrifts,
& Mortgages Banks
◦ Provides guarantees to investors in Mortgage backed securities for
timely payments

Has strict requirements for mortgages in the pool◦ Each mortgage must be, and must remain, insured or guaranteed by a
federal agency FHA, VA, RHS or PIH.
◦ Mortgage insurance makes the lender whole if the borrower defaults

SPV: There is really no risk to the bank with an SPV
◦ Pass-through payments are based on the cash flows of the pool
◦ If mortgages go bad the investors receive lower payments. The SPV is not
in danger of defaulting on its obligated payments

1.
Reduces Regulatory tax
◦ Banks face substantial regulatory costs for holding risky assets on their
balance sheet
◦ Banks can avoid these regulatory costs by securitizing risky assets
2.
Reduces Gap exposure (refinancing risk)
◦ Mortgages are financing using short-term debt which must be refinanced.
That rate will change but the mortgage interest rate will remain constant
3.
Illiquidity Risk
◦ Mortgages are illiquid and will likely need to be sold at a large discount
◦ Securitizations are more liquid so they can usually be sold at less of a
discount.
